Frank Lentini, born with a parasitic twin had 3 legs, 4 feet, 16 toes, and 2 functioning sets of genitals (1884-1966).

Pictured here is Francesco "Frank" A. Lentini, an Italian-American showman who was born with a parasitic twin. The twin was attached at the base of his spine and consisted of a pelvis bone, male genitalia, and a full-sized leg extending from the right side of Lentini's hip, with a small foot protruding from its knee.

Lentini joined the sideshow business as "The Great Lentini" with the Ringling Brothers Circus. His career spanned over forty years, his peers often called him "The King". He worked with every major circus and sideshow there was including Barnum and Bailey and Buffalo Bill's Wild West Show.

In 1907, he married Theresa Murray and they had four children: Giuseppina (Josephine), Natale (Ned), Francesco (Frank) Junior and Giacomo (James). When the couple separated in 1935, he spent the rest of his life with Helen Shupe. Lentini died of lung failure on September 21, 1966, at the age of 77.
